The 274 poems in this anthology are pruned from 12 previously-published collections that contain approximately 700 poems plus 700 explanations: 99 tiny droplets of condensation, 99 reflections on landscapes, 99 broken buildings, 99 missed calls, 198 explanations, 200 explanations, 49 songs of silent sirens, 49 islands set in a single sea, 49 gods we serve, 49 insights into the smoking abyss, 49 chances to exist and 49 counter positions. I have also included 14 poems pruned from the next book I am writing: 49 troublesome thoughts. Gardeners know the truth of the paradox 'pruning encourages growth'. I hope these modest roots and slender branches pruned from deeper roots and sturdier branches will encourage the growth of your ever-burgeoning tree of knowledge, but the fruit that your tree bears will always be your own unique truth.
